The second round of the 2023 A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am gets underway Friday, February 3, at Pebble Beach, Spyglass Hill and Monterey Peninsula CC. Here’s what you need to know to watch Round 2 on TV or online.

Previewing Pebble Beach Round 2

World No. 11 Viktor Hovland is making just his second PGA Tour start of 2023 this week at the A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am. Despite the small sample size, Hovland is looking good early in the season.

He followed up a win at Tiger Woods’ Hero World Challenge in December with a T18 at the Sentry Tournament of Champions in January. On Thursday, Hovland began his tournament at difficult Spyglass Hill, where he recorded a respectable two-under 70.

Despite his solid opening round, Hovland finds himself well back of the early lead held by 29-year-old Hank Lebioda, who fired an eight-under 63 at MPCC to take the lead heading into Friday’s second round.

How to watch A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am Round 2 on TV

Golf Channel will air the second round of the 2023 A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am on TV with a three-hour telecast from 3-6 p.m. ET on Friday.

How to stream A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am Round 2 online

You can stream the second round of the 2023 A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am via PGA Tour Live on ESPN+, which will have exclusive coverage beginning at 11:30 a.m. ET on Friday, in addition to featured group coverage and a simulcast of the Golf Channel coverage. Fans can also stream the second round of Golf Channel TV coverage via Peacock.
